Development Components
The main factors that support the effective and efficient implementation of development so that the work can be completed on time, economical and in accordance with the expected include: Human Factors (manpower), Equipment and Materials. Once when I was a student at a college, my lecturer always reminded me of the most important factor in the world of implementation is BMW (cost, quality, and time).
Human Factors (Labor)
Implementation of work supervised by a Bachelor of Civil Engineering (S1 or D-III);
Self-monitoring can be done by homeowners directly.
Conducted by a trained and experienced person or highly motivated;
The employee's organization consists of at least: Chief of Handyman, Tailor, and Assistant Handyman (kernet);
Do by specialist (Tukang) respectively, such as: Drillman, Stone Mason, Ceramic Tailor, Carpenter, Plumbing Plumber and others.
Facility and Equipment Factors
Water and electricity are major factors in the implementation of development;
Sufficient equipment is needed in facilitating the process of development implementation;
General equipment required include: Hoe, Spade, Hammers, Chainsaws, Waterpass, Meters, Boots, Buckets, Project Helmets, Gloves, Screwdrivers and Pliers:
Equipment at the time of casting include: Molen Machine, Tub measuring, cement spoon, and rubber hammer.
